. While one prioritizes deep-seated intellectual inquiry, the other masters the art of high-stakes, fast-paced storytelling, illustrating the broad spectrum of what "popular" means in the digital age. The Intellectual Marathon: Lex Fridman

Lex Fridman has carved out a massive niche in the popular media landscape by leaning into complexity. His long-form podcast—covering topics from AI and robotics to philosophy and history—serves as a counterweight to "snackable" content.

Content Philosophy: Prioritizes the "human condition" and deep dives into scientific or philosophical frameworks.

Media Impact: With over 4.8 million subscribers and 850+ million views, Fridman proves there is a significant market for three-hour conversations with everyone from tech moguls to martial artists.

Unique Selling Point: Authenticity through long-form, unedited dialogue that challenges the curated nature of traditional social media. The Narrative Sprint: Ryan Trahan

In contrast to the marathon sessions of the Lex Fridman Podcast, Ryan Trahan represents the pinnacle of modern, high-production entertainment. His content is defined by high-stakes challenges and meticulous pacing that keeps viewers hooked from the first second.

Content Philosophy: Uses "stunt" journalism and extreme challenges (e.g., crossing America on a penny) to create high-tension narrative arcs.

Media Impact: Trahan dominates the "entertainment" sector of YouTube, leveraging the platform’s algorithm to reach broad audiences through relatable yet extraordinary storytelling.

Unique Selling Point: Exceptional editing and "hooks" that cater to the evolving attention spans of a digitally native audience. Popular Media: Bridging the Gap

The Architect of Depth: Lex Fridman

Lex Fridman represents a shift toward "slow media." In an era of rapid-fire snippets, his podcast prioritizes hours-long, uninterrupted conversations with scientists, tech leaders, and philosophers. His content strategy is built on:

Radical Empathy: Approaching controversial figures with a goal of understanding rather than "gotcha" journalism.

Intellectual Curiosity: Bringing technical depth—rooted in his background in AI and robotics—to mainstream media.

Community Trust: Fostering a devoted audience that values nuances over headlines, effectively creating an "intellectual town square." The Catalyst of Sentiment: Ryan Cohen

Ryan Cohen’s influence on popular media is inextricably linked to the "meme stock" phenomenon and the rise of the retail investor. As the founder of Chewy and Chairman of GameStop, his media presence is characterized by:

Minimalist Communication: Using cryptic tweets and rare public appearances to spark massive community speculation and analysis.

The "Main Street" Hero Narrative: Popular media often portrays him as a disruptor challenging traditional Wall Street institutions, a narrative that resonates deeply with the digital-native generation.

Cultural Symbiosis: His actions frequently trend on platforms like Reddit and X (formerly Twitter), where the line between financial news and entertainment blurs. Comparative Influence on Popular Media

Lex Fridman: The Podcaster and AI Enthusiast

Lex Fridman is a Russian-American podcaster, artificial intelligence (AI) researcher, and MIT (Massachusetts Institute of Technology) researcher. He is best known for hosting the Lex Fridman Podcast, which features in-depth conversations with a wide range of guests, including scientists, philosophers, entrepreneurs, and thought leaders. With over 3 million subscribers on YouTube and millions of downloads on podcast platforms, Lex Fridman has established himself as a significant voice in the world of entertainment content and popular media.

Fridman's content focuses on exploring the intersection of technology, science, and human experience. His podcast has featured guests such as Elon Musk, Sam Harris, and Neil deGrasse Tyson, allowing him to tap into the expertise and insights of leading figures in various fields. Fridman's interviewing style is characterized by his curiosity, empathy, and willingness to challenge his guests, making for engaging and thought-provoking discussions.

The Spectrum of Influence

Let’s define the endpoints.

Pole A: Lex Fridman (The Intellectual Glue) Lex’s content is long, slow, and dense. His podcast (often 3+ hours) requires active listening. He talks to enemies (like Kanye West or Ben Shapiro) with a smile. He asks about love, physics, and Jiu-Jitsu. His audience doesn't watch for the algorithm; they watch for the signal in the noise.

Pole B: Ryan’s World (The Sensory Firehose) Ryan’s content is short, loud, and bright. His videos last 10 minutes (max). He relies on surprise, consumption, and visual chaos. He talks to his parents or a cartoon mascot. His audience (ages 3–7) watches for the dopamine.
